Output 180d71707ec8913ed8cd48fd90805a24ba62f9958e668387fb76f52310d1db79:0

value
299645521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07660345096dafa4d435212eae79991c9b4a68ea OP_EQUALVERIFY OP_CHECKSIG
address
LKu5CXYkd5fD1x516wiYt64tfBXRZyjv2i
transaction
180d71707ec8913ed8cd48fd90805a24ba62f9958e668387fb76f52310d1db79
spent
true